The Ho Chi Minh City Party Committee has just issued Regulations on purchasing and processing information to serve the work of preventing and combating corruption and negativity in Ho Chi Minh City.

Accordingly, the Ho Chi Minh City Party Committee determined that information serving the work of preventing and combating corruption and negativity is information denouncing and reflecting corrupt acts of people with positions and powers; and negativity of cadres, party members, civil servants and public employees within the scope of management of the Ho Chi Minh City Party Committee and People's Committee.

Buying information is not a civil transaction. It is considered a form of encouragement and motivation for those who provide valuable information, meeting professional requirements to serve the work of preventing and combating corruption and negativity.

Information providers are domestic and foreign organizations and individuals living and working in Vietnam; not including organizations and individuals specializing in anti-corruption and anti-negativity work and cadres, civil servants and employees at other agencies and organizations with the authority to receive information.

The person receiving, processing information and "buying information" is the Steering Committee for Anti-Corruption and Negativity of Ho Chi Minh City; members of the Steering Committee; the Standing Body of the Steering Committee is the Internal Affairs Committee of the Ho Chi Minh City Party Committee.

According to regulations, the reception, processing of information and purchase of information must ensure confidentiality, timeliness, accuracy and compliance with regulations. Ensure confidentiality and safety for information providers according to Party regulations and State laws on the protection of whistleblowers, discoverers, whistleblowers, and those fighting against corruption, waste and negativity.

The reception of information by the informant must follow the “one-way” principle, meaning that the informant only meets, exchanges, works, and provides information directly to the recipient, without going through an intermediary. The identity of the informant must be marked with a code number.

The Ho Chi Minh City Party Committee requires that information reflecting and denouncing corruption and negative acts must ensure authenticity and completeness, reflect the content and details of the incident or phenomenon that has occurred; exist in the form of traditional data or electronic data, have content expressed in Vietnamese, clearly and specifically; not be edited to change the true nature of the incident or phenomenon; information can be verified.

The information must also have new content, not yet provided by any organization or individual, and not yet received and resolved by a competent authority. The information reflecting and denouncing is evidence for a case or violation and must have a direct or indirect connection to the case or violation that is legal according to regulations.

The person providing information will be guaranteed absolute confidentiality of their full name, address, handwriting and other personal information when providing information; and will receive a maximum payment of 10 million VND/news (case) if the information provided is accurate, helping the authorities have a basis to investigate, verify and handle corrupt and negative acts.

Informants are also considered for rewards according to Party regulations and State laws for organizations and individuals with outstanding achievements in denouncing and detecting acts of corruption and negativity; they are requested to request the Standing Committee of the Steering Committee, the Head of the Steering Committee and the Standing Body of the Steering Committee to request competent agencies, organizations and individuals to apply protection measures according to the provisions of law on protecting whistleblowers when there are signs of intimidation, retaliation and persecution.

In addition, the information provider must also be responsible for the authenticity of the information and documents provided; compensate for damages or be prosecuted for their intentional denunciation or false reflection. At the same time, they are obliged to provide and supplement information and documents on corrupt and negative acts; must not disseminate, disclose, destroy information, or falsify original information while the competent authority has not yet concluded the investigation and verification of the information.

The Ho Chi Minh City Party Committee requests that the process of receiving and processing information must not disclose the results of the settlement of relevant authorities when they have not been made public according to regulations. In case the provided information is not accepted, within 10 working days from the date of receiving the information, the Standing Agency of the Steering Committee for Anti-Corruption and Negative Action is responsible for notifying the information provider, returning relevant documents and materials or archiving them according to regulations.

People provide information to the Steering Committee for anti-corruption and negativity of Ho Chi Minh City in the following forms:

- Direct information provision: the information provider directly reflects and provides information to the Steering Committee, members of the Steering Committee and the information receiving department of the Steering Committee's Standing Body at the working headquarters or appropriate location.

- Provide indirect information :

+ By post
